What is the basso continuo​

Arts
1 answer:
riadik2000 [5.3K]3 years ago
5 0

Basso continuo is a form of musical accompaniment used in the Baroque period. It means continuous bass.

What american museum paid $6.9 million to exhibit artwork on loan from the louvre from 2006-2009?
BartSMP [9]

ANSWER: High Museum of Art at Atlanta and Terra Foundation for American Art at Chicago

EXPLANATION: In 2006, an agreement for exchange of art was made between the government owned The Louvre and privately owned art museums which are High Museum of Art at Atlanta and Terra Foundation for American Art at Chicago for an exchange of $6.9 million. It was decided that The Louvre will share its collection and the private museums will cover $18 million cost of the program. The $6.9 Million as paid towards the refurbishment of The Louvre.
